Technical Solution for Drop Cable Laying

Proper drop cable laying requires adherence to standards, careful handling, correct routing, and protection measures to ensure long-term reliability and safety.Cable Selection and PreparationChoose the appropriate cable type based on the installation environment: FTTH flat drop cables or aerial drop cables for overhead installations, and suitable twisted pair or coaxial cables for copper networks . Prepare the cable ends according to manufacturer guidelines, including splicing, termination, and connector attachment, to maintain signal integrity .Routing and Path ConsiderationsClear the installation path of debris, vegetation, or obstacles for both aerial and underground routes .Minimize sharp bends and tight corners; maintain a minimum bending radius of 20 times the cable diameter during installation and 10 times for static use .For long runs, use gentle curves and avoid unsupported spans to reduce mechanical stress .Pulling and TensionLimit pulling tension to 80–100 N for manual installation; use a tension meter for long-distance pulls to prevent over-tensioning .Apply cable lubricant in conduits to reduce friction and prevent damage during installation .Underground InstallationDig trenches deep enough to protect the cable from accidental damage and environmental factors .Use bedding material such as 75 mm of sand below and above the cable to prevent mechanical damage .Place cable covers like concrete tiles or warning tapes above the cable and backfill with selected soil free of stones and organic matter .Ensure proper compaction to avoid future soil settlement that could damage the cable .Aerial InstallationSecure cables to poles or building structures using appropriate hardware, leaving adequate slack to accommodate tension changes due to weather .Use UV-resistant jackets for outdoor cables and consider conduit protection for long-term exposure .Conduit and Wall PenetrationInstall cables in clean, smooth conduits to prevent abrasion .Use wall bushings or conduit sleeves at entry/exit points to protect against mechanical stress .Earthing and SafetyFor underground or instrument cables, ensure proper earthing according to IEC 60364 to maintain signal integrity and safety .Select earth cable size to safely carry fault currents without overheating or failure .Compliance with StandardsFollow IEC standards for underground cable laying to ensure mechanical protection, electrical safety, and environmental security .Refer to IEEE 525-2007 for substation and high-voltage cable installations to minimize failures and ensure proper protection .Splicing and TerminationUse fusion or mechanical splicing depending on cable type .Ensure all terminations are properly executed to minimize signal loss and maintain network performance . By following these technical recommendations, drop cable installations can achieve long-term reliability, reduced maintenance costs, and compliance with safety and operational standards.
